This is one of those reviews that I am unsure whether I really want to write it....not because there would be anything bad, but because the place is really busy and it's tough to get a reservation. But, after the meal, it's really hard to not share how delicious it was. The pesto rossa they serve with bread is exceptional. The ravioli was a special for the night, homemade, and amazing. It was veal inside with a cream sauce, garlic and peas. Main course was pan seared scallops with a cream sauce (rosemary), balsamic drizzle and olive oil and garlic spinach. Also, I tried the calamari salad, also ridiculously good with a lemon dressing and grilled flavors and textures that only come with a perfect sear. Dessert was their homemade panna Cotta with fresh fruit and a raspberry sauce. Their espresso, also delicious.
